Experience the Majestic Standseilbahn Engelberg-Gerschnialp
Discover the breathtaking views and outdoor adventures at Standseilbahn Engelberg-Gerschnialp, your gateway to the Swiss Alps.
Standseilbahn Engelberg-Gerschnialp offers breathtaking views of the Swiss Alps, making it an unforgettable experience for tourists. This funicular railway connects Engelberg to the stunning Gerschnialp region, inviting visitors to witness the pristine beauty of nature while enjoying a leisurely ride. Perfect for families and adventure seekers alike, the Standseilbahn is a gateway to hiking trails and relaxation spots with panoramic mountain vistas.

Getting There
-
Car
If you're driving, head towards Engelberg via the A2 motorway. Once you arrive in Engelberg, follow the signs for the town center. Park your car in one of the public parking areas available in the center. The nearest parking to the Standseilbahn Engelberg-Gerschnialp is the 'TITLIS' parking garage. After parking, it's a short walk to the standseilbahn station located on the main street, just follow signs for 'Gerschnialp'.
-
Public Transportation
If you're using public transportation, take a train to Engelberg from major Swiss cities like Lucerne or Zurich. The Engelberg train station is located in the town center. Once you arrive at the station, exit and walk towards the main street. Follow the signs for 'Gerschnialp' which will lead you to the Standseilbahn Engelberg-Gerschnialp station. The walk from the train station will take approximately 10 minutes.
-
Walking
For those already in Engelberg, you can easily walk to the Standseilbahn Engelberg-Gerschnialp. Start at the Engelberg train station and head towards the main street. Continue straight until you reach the standseilbahn station. It is located just past the main square. The walk should take around 10 minutes depending on your pace.
